When West Coast High School drops the funding for the drama department, five unlikely teens come together to get it back. Eli, the bad boy, who says he's just there for the free food. Cara, the weird girl, who doesn't fit in anywhere else except for on stage. Asher, the jock, who has a secret passion for Shakespearean plays. Carly, the rich girl, who owes a certain favor to a certain someone. And then you have Lacy, your average senior student, who's working her butt off to get into the college of her dreams. Heads butt, personalities clash, and a whole lot of truths are revealed. But together they stand, as the drama club. A novel of friendship, humor, love and five determined minds who have a drive to change things one drama department at a time.
